Otrivine Antistin is a dual action eye drop containing two active ingredients; Xylometazoline Hydrochloride (0.05%), a long acting vasoconstrictor and Antazoline Sulphate (0.5%) which is a H1 receptor antagonist.
Xylometazoline Hydrochloride reduces eye redness.
Antazoline Sulphate has antihistaminic, anticholinergic and local anaesthetic properties. The primary mediator of inflammation in allergic conjunctivitis appears to be histamine. Antazoline reduces histamine induced responses including itching.
For local administration into the eye.
Adults: 1 or 2 drops instilled 2 - 3 times a day.
Otrivine Antistin Eye Drops should not be used for more than seven consecutive days.
The dispenser remains sterile until the original closure is broken. Patients must be instructed to avoid allowing the tip of the dispensing container to contact the eye or surrounding structures as this may contaminate the solution.
If more than one medication needs to be instilled in the eye, an interval of at least 5 minutes between application of the different medicinal products must be allowed.
Shelf life is 28 days after opening.
1 x 10ml Polyethylene dropper bottle.
